Lake Burley Griffin is the man made lake in the middle of town and the prime species here is carp. Whilst they are fun to catch, if you are looking to sample some of the regions trout fishing then you will probably be better served getting out of town a little.
The Cotter and Goodradigbee rivers are about within an hour of of town and may be worth a try. Alternatively, you could head out a little further an fish the Snowy Mountain area, plenty of smaller streams to give the tenkara a workout. There are also quite a few guides operating in the Snowy region which should make things a little more straightforward.
